National Guard mounted helmet, Model 1814, Restoration period. Two-piece hot-molded helmet in fine black patent leather, with all fittings in silver-plated copper. Front plate depicting a large oval shield with a fleur-de-lys in the center, topped by the royal crown and framed on either side by a palm, an oak branch and a laurel branch. Back band embossed with oak branches. Leather visor encircled by a folded rush straddling the outer edge. Leather neck cover. Chinstraps: leather chinstraps sheathed in black velvet covered with a series of silver-plated brass scales. Square-section tubular plumet holder. Crest with two fins, embossed with a series of gadroons decreasing towards the rear, separated by acanthus leaves. Black horsehair caterpillar. Waxed leather headband. Posterior nib. Accidents on the inside
